Sean Rhodes is a solicitor and trusted advisor to companies navigating the complexities of the UK immigration system, with a particular focus on strategic workforce planning. He partners closely with clients to align their immigration needs with broader business objectives, offering tailored advice that supports successful project delivery and long-term growth.

Sean leads Fragomen’s Creative Industry Group, where he works hand-in-hand with studios, production companies and other creative enterprises. From analyzing visa options and labor market dynamics to advising on short-term immigration routes and sponsorship solutions, Sean helps creative clients plan and execute productions efficiently. His deep involvement includes government liaison work, offering strategic input on how immigration policy changes affect the sector and advocating for responses to RFEs and regulatory shifts.

In addition to his creative industry work, Sean plays a pivotal role in supporting clients in the renewable energy and maritime sectors - industries that often operate under intense, last-minute timelines. He helps organizations stay compliant while meeting fast-paced project demands in a post-Brexit regulatory environment.

Sean’s reach also extends into IT, engineering and fast-moving consumer goods, where his ability to anticipate challenges and deliver practical solutions has proven invaluable.

What sets Sean apart is his relationship-first approach. He prioritizes understanding each client’s unique goals, listening deeply and crafting strategies that solve more than just immigration challenges - he helps deliver business success. Clients value his ability to make every relationship personal, offering thoughtful, empathetic support throughout their journey.

Sean speaks English and Spanish.

Experience

Successfully managed workforce planning for productions in the Creative Industries, utilizing the Creative Worker route and other short-term immigration options.

Managed the work permit process for a large group move of more than 80 staff members on a special energy project, ensuring crucial project deadlines were met.

Liaised with government contacts to help secure amendments to short-term work exceptions for the energy sector.
